
The Cult of Domesticity is a book based off of the Ballerina Farm, a working farm in Utah run by Hannah Neeleman (a former ballet dancer) and her husband, who document their traditional lifestyle and large family that consists of eight children.
Drawing from Megan Agnew's article "Meet the queen of the 'trad wives' (and her eight children)", this 30-page book explores Hannah Neeleman's transformation from aspiring ballerina to modern homesteader. Through strategic use of negative space and isolated dialogue, the design reflects the void between abandoned dreams and embraced reality.
